Hadith 1271

حَدَّثَنِي مَالِك، عَنْ ابْنِ شِهَابٍ أَنَّهُ سَمِعَهُ، يَقُولُ : مَضَتِ السُّنَّةُ أَنَّ " الْعَبْدَ إِذَا أُعْتِقَ، تَبِعَهُ مَالُهُ " .
Ibn Shihab used to say that the established practice is that when a slave is set free, his property belongs to him.
. قَالَ مَالِك : وَمِمَّا يُبَيِّنُ ذَلِكَ أَيْضًا، أَنَّ الْعَبْدَ وَالْمُكَاتَبَ إِذَا أَفْلَسَا أُخِذَتْ أَمْوَالُهُمَا وَأُمَّهَاتُ أَوْلَادِهِمَا وَلَمْ تُؤْخَذْ أَوْلَادُهُمَا، لِأَنَّهُمْ لَيْسُوا بِأَمْوَالٍ لَهُمَا . قَالَ مَالِك : وَمِمَّا يُبَيِّنُ ذَلِكَ أَيْضًا، أَنَّ الْعَبْدَ إِذَا بِيعَ وَاشْتَرَطَ الَّذِي ابْتَاعَهُ مَالَهُ لَمْ يَدْخُلْ وَلَدُهُ فِي مَالِهِ .
Imam Malik, may Allah have mercy on him, said: Its evidence is also that when a slave is sold and the buyer stipulates the condition of taking his property, then the offspring will not be included in it.
قَالَ مَالِك : وَمِمَّا يُبَيِّنُ ذَلِكَ أَيْضًا، أَنَّ الْعَبْدَ إِذَا جَرَحَ أُخِذَ هُوَ وَمَالُهُ وَلَمْ يُؤْخَذْ وَلَدُهُ
Imam Malik, may Allah have mercy on him, said: If a slave injures someone, then he himself and his property will be held liable for the blood money, but his children will not be held accountable.
قَالَ مَالِك : وَمِمَّا يُبَيِّنُ ذَلِكَ، أَنَّ الْعَبْدَ إِذَا عَتِقَ تَبِعَهُ مَالُهُ، أَنَّ الْمُكَاتَبَ إِذَا كُوتِبَ تَبِعَهُ مَالُهُ، وَإِنْ لَمْ يَشْتَرِطْهُ الْمُكَاتِبُ، وَذَلِكَ أَنَّ عَقْدَ الْكِتَابَةِ هُوَ عَقْدُ الْوَلَاءِ إِذَا تَمَّ ذَلِكَ، وَلَيْسَ مَالُ الْعَبْدِ وَالْمُكَاتَبِ بِمَنْزِلَةِ مَا كَانَ لَهُمَا مِنْ وَلَدٍ، إِنَّمَا أَوْلَادُهُمَا بِمَنْزِلَةِ رِقَابِهِمَا لَيْسُوا بِمَنْزِلَةِ أَمْوَالِهِمَا، لِأَنَّ السُّنَّةَ الَّتِي لَا اخْتِلَافَ فِيهَا أَنَّ الْعَبْدَ إِذَا عَتَقَ تَبِعَهُ مَالُهُ وَلَمْ يَتْبَعْهُ وَلَدُهُ، وَأَنَّ الْمُكَاتَبَ إِذَا كُوتِبَ تَبِعَهُ مَالُهُ وَلَمْ يَتْبَعْهُ وَلَدُهُ .
Imam Malik, may Allah have mercy on him, said that when a slave is made a mukatab (contracted for freedom), whatever wealth he possesses will remain his own, and this ruling does not apply to children. The children that the slave has at the time of being freed or contracted will belong to the master. Imam Malik, may Allah have mercy on him, said: The evidence for this is that when a slave or a mukatab becomes insolvent, their wealth and umm walad (slave woman who bore a child) will be taken, but not their children, because children are not the property of the slave.
